    7, FANNYSTONE ROAD, GRIMSBY, DN34 4EQ

    This semi-detached leasehold property on Fannystone Road last sold in August 2022 for £169,950. Based on price growth in the DN34 district since then, its estimated current value is £165,861 — placing it in the 16th percentile nationally and the 70th percentile within DN34. The property covers 65 m² (700 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,552 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
